Snake-Eyes: The Origin, Part 2
Snake-Eyes’ history is still a topic of conversation, revealing exactly why Snake-Eyes is now silent and masked at all times. Add to this an encounter with Storm Shadow, who claims to have been falsely accused, and the plot thickens.
